    Fabbed up an amp cooling system for my stereo rack. My ceiling fan is starting to make grinding sounds so I needed an alternative. This Airplate S3 runs off USB and I have it plugged into the back of the Cambridge Audio 851N so when it gets turned on it's on. I have it set on low which is really quiet and draws cool air from the front.

    The Marantz AV8801 I got off Audiogon 7 months ago for $750 was not outputting sound from the front right channel. After doing all the routine trouble shooting of wire switching, replacement, etc., I decided to tap into the right channel of the zone 2 output. Well, that was clumsy at best and limited the sources available. I contacted Marantz, hoping they could help in some way...

    While waiting for that help, I read in the manual:

    MULTI CH STEREO- This mode is for enjoying stereo sound from all speakers.
    The same sound as that from the front speakers (L/R) is played back at the
    same level from the surround speakers (L/R) and surround back speakers (L/R).

    Well, for my needs that is perfect. I ran a balanced cable from the right surround output to the right channel of my ATI AT543NC.

    Problem solved and shopping for a replacement pre-pro can be postponed for another day.
